How to uninstall or reinstall the app in Azure DevOps?

If you need to remove the extension or reinstall it to fix issues, Azure DevOps allows you to manage everything directly from your organization settings. Follow the steps below.


How to Uninstall the App

1. Open your Azure DevOps Organization

Go to https://dev.azure.com/ and select the organization where the app is installed.


2. Go to Organization Settings

Click Organization Settings in the bottom-left corner of the sidebar.


3. Open the Extensions section

Navigate to:

Extensions → Installed Extensions

Here you'll see a list of all apps installed in your organization.


4. Find the app (e.g., Time in State for Azure DevOps)

Scroll through the list or use the search bar to locate the extension.


5. Click “Uninstall”

Open the extension details and click Uninstall.

Azure DevOps may also prompt you to:

  • Confirm the removal

  • Choose where to uninstall if you have multiple organizations

Uninstallation usually takes a few seconds.


🔄 How to Reinstall the App

If you need to reinstall the app (e.g., after troubleshooting, incorrect setup, or permission issues), follow these steps:


1. Go to the Azure DevOps Marketplace

Open:
https://marketplace.visualstudio.com/azuredevops

Search for the app you want to reinstall.


2. Open the extension page

For example: Time in State for Azure DevOps

Click Get it Free (or Get if you already purchased a subscription).


3. Choose your Azure DevOps Organization

Select the same organization where the app was previously installed.

Click Install.


4. Approve permissions

Confirm the required permissions requested by the extension.


5. Wait for installation to complete

Installation is automatic and takes around 10–30 seconds.

Once the extension is installed again, you can access it under:

  • Boards

  • Project Settings → Extensions

  • or the specific app section, depending on the tool


🛠 When should you reinstall the app?

Reinstallation is helpful when:

  • The app does not appear in Boards, Dashboards, or extensions

  • Reports or widgets are not loading

  • Permissions were incorrectly configured

  • Azure DevOps shows an installation error

  • Metadata or configuration failed to sync

Often, reinstalling refreshes the extension files and reconnects it properly to your organization.


❗ Important Notes

  • Uninstalling the app does not remove your Azure DevOps data.

  • After reinstalling, your reports and analytics will continue working normally.

  • Only Organization Owners or Project Collection Administrators can install or uninstall apps.
